**09:47 — DocSweep linter starts failing every PR**

Quick note for reviewers: the DocSweep upgrade at 09:31 shipped a rule that flagged every heading with a trailing colon — which is, uh, all of them. CI went red across Bramblework repos for 16 minutes until we pinned the old version. The fix is in review now; the pinned build's token is below.

pipeline stamp: htk6_35e0c9

**Finance Review Summary – Lumoset Plus Tier**

Quick recap for department heads: the new Lumoset Plus subscription launched mid-quarter and is tracking nicely — conversions from the free tier are about double what Rhea's team modelled. Churn is low so far, though support costs crept up thanks to the priority-queue promise. Marek wants a pricing sensitivity check before we push the annual plan harder. Overall, cautiously optimistic. For context on where this fits in next year's roadmap, see the note below.

internal memo for taguf-kafop: Novmirax Group plans to lower the Oliius list price by 42.0 percent in March. The board signed off on a budget of $367.8 million for Project Belael. The renewal with Drumirax Logistics closes at $302.4 million a year, 54.0 percent below the last contract. Project Kelys slips by a full year because of the staffing delay.

**Ticket QX-4471: Calendar sync conflict overwrites attendee list**

Meetloom's two-way sync with Daybreak Calendar drops attendees when both sides edit within the same window. Last-write-wins logic applies to the whole event object, not per-field. Security angle: overwritten data includes private attendee visibility flags, so a conflict can expose hidden participants. Repro steps attached. Fix lands in build referenced by the token below.

build token for kagaf-hahof: htk14_9d3d4d26d7d8de

## Releases

Heads up for the sync: the Gravelsmith SQL linter rules are now versioned with the release, not pulled from trunk, so a rule change can't break an in-flight deploy anymore. If your migration trips the new keyword-casing rule, just fix it — don't add exceptions to the ruleset without flagging it here first. Each ruleset bundle gets signed at tag time so downstream repos can trust what they pull. Signing for the current release cycle uses the key shown below.

deploy key for kafof-kaguf: bky9_WnPyu8S2E